Study Links AWGC Cachexia to Poorer Quality of Life

  • Jiangsu University in China conducted a study of 431 gastric cancer patients to assess cachexia.
  • The study found 37.1% met AWGC criteria for cachexia and 38.5% met Fearon's criteria.
  • Patients classified by AWGC criteria had lower skeletal muscle and fat indices and poorer health-related quality of life.
  • AWGC-defined cachexia was independently linked to poor quality of life, whereas Fearon-defined cachexia was not.
